The Reuben Poster
November 21, 2021
2020 Poster
January 5, 2020
The Infamous Future Poster
September 25, 2019
Its Time Poster
October 21, 2018
Plug Poster
April 11, 2016
Trust Poster
March 9, 2015
Bronze 56K  Enron Poster
July 13, 2014
Loony Bin Poster
December 12, 2013